Apple Developer Academy Expands AI Education Initiatives in South Korea

Apple is expanding its educational reach in South Korea through the Apple Developer Academy, launching specialized summer programs focused on artificial intelligence and machine learning. These initiatives are designed to provide students and aspiring developers with hands-on experience in building AI-powered applications using Apple’s proprietary frameworks, including Core ML and Create ML. The programs build upon the company’s existing curriculum in Seoul and Pohang, which focuses on Swift programming, UI/UX design, and professional soft skills.

How the Apple Developer Academy AI Training Works

The Apple Developer Academy utilizes a challenge-based learning model, a pedagogical approach where students identify real-world problems and develop functional software solutions. According to Apple’s official program documentation, the AI-specific tracks require participants to move beyond theoretical concepts. Instead, students work directly with Core ML, which allows developers to integrate machine learning models into apps with high performance and low latency on devices. The curriculum emphasizes privacy-by-design, ensuring that AI models process data locally on the device rather than relying on cloud-based server processing.

Eligibility and Application Process

Participation in the summer sessions is open to individuals who meet specific criteria set by the academy’s local partners, such as POSTECH in Pohang. While requirements vary by session, applicants typically must be South Korean residents with a demonstrated interest in software development. Unlike traditional university courses, the academy does not require a computer science degree. According to the POSTECH Apple Developer Academy portal, the selection process prioritizes creative problem-solving abilities and a collaborative mindset over existing technical mastery. Why On-Device AI Matters for Developers

The focus on on-device machine learning represents a strategic shift in how mobile applications handle data. By utilizing the Neural Engine within Apple’s A-series and M-series chips, developers can create applications that remain functional without an internet connection. This approach provides two primary advantages:

  • Enhanced Privacy: User data stays on the device, minimizing the risks associated with data transmission and cloud storage.
  • Improved Performance: Processing data locally results in faster response times for features like image recognition, natural language processing, and predictive text.

What Happens Next for Academy Graduates

Graduates of the Apple Developer Academy often transition into roles within the growing South Korean tech sector or launch their own startups. Because the curriculum is built around the Swift programming language, participants gain a competitive edge in the iOS app ecosystem. Many alumni leverage the “Challenge-Based Learning” methodology to build portfolios that satisfy the requirements of major domestic and international tech firms. As Apple continues to integrate generative AI features across its platforms, the skills learned in these summer programs become increasingly relevant for developers aiming to build the next generation of intelligent mobile experiences.
